Join Scott to study the structure, expressivity and aesthetic richness of the human form, with demonstrations from Scott, class activities and one-on-one feedback in a supportive and enjoyable environment.

Course content is based on my Form, Gesture, Anatomy Course, focussing on the Elements of Classical Figure Drawing section, and we will apply this to drawing the nude model from life.

Over 8 sessions, we will cover the following areas - both separately and then reintegrating them together.

  1. Blocking in and accuracy - key landmarks, orienting masses in space in relation to each other, analysing form and gesture in essentials, in particular the torso

  2. Thinking in Volumes - seeing/feeling and drawing the body as large masses, and constructing/ depicting subforms using only line.

  3. Design principles in the human body (and nature generally) - S curves, C curves, and straight lines, line weight, harmony and variation, counterbalance, extending lines as far as possible, looking for a major line of design and related lines

  4. Gesture and exaggeration - finding swing and rhythm to the line, taking the observed pose and exaggerating this slightly, telling a story with the body

  5. Rendering - principles of rendering form in light and shade, types of rendering, points about rendering in different media, options for direction of linear rendering,
